一、【普通<input>的自定义指令操作】:先在入口文件注册一个全局自定义指令 //main.jsVue.directive('focus', {inserted (el, binding, vnode) {//聚焦元素el.focus() } }) 【普通<input>的自定义指令使用】:v-"+指令名" //index.vue<input v-focus placeholder="因为有v-focus,所以我聚焦了" /> ...
//注册一个全局自定义指令 `v-focus`Vue.directive('focus', {//当被绑定的元素插入到 DOM 中时……inserted: function (el) {//聚焦元素el.focus() el.querySelector('input').focus() } }) 如果想注册局部指令,组件中也接受一个directives的选项: directives: {//注册一个局部的自定义指令 v-focusf...
vue与elementUI中给el-input绑定键盘按键代码如下:<el-input placeholder="店铺名称" clearable v-model="queryObj.shopname" @keyup.enter.native="query"> <template slot="prepend">店铺名称</template> </el-input> 常⽤按键修饰符 别名修饰符键值修饰符对应按键 .delete.8/.46回格/删除 .tab.9制表 ...
<el-input v-model="inTxt"placeholder="请输入您要搜索的信息"@keyup.enter.native="search"@focus='focus($event)'></el-input>/// 鼠标获得焦点之后,全选已经输入的字符串。focus(event){event.currentTarget.select();},/deep/input::-webkit-input-placeholder{color:@txtColor;font-size:20px;}/deep...
首先,我在父组件中使用了reactive 定义了一个form 属性,并且使用了watchEffect 监视本地数据的变化。最后将 form 传递给子组件,并将数据与el-input绑定。而后发现:输入框无法实现输入效果,显示的数据是初始绑定的值: // --- 父组件 --- //in script const form = reactive({ name: '', ... }); watchEf...
在vue中可以在@input事件中使用Trim函数来去掉前后两端空格,再使用replace方法来删除中间空格,此时的值删除所有空格,用户输入值中的空格就会被过滤掉了。 <template> <div> <el-input v-model="searchValue" @input="handleInput"></el-input> </div> ...
使用el-input组件时,有个父级事件被输入框触发了,因此需要解决一下事件冒泡 后面如果不执行函数或语句就不用跟 ‘=’ 号了
若依前后端分离版 后台对象没有这个属性,在<el-form> 额外增加一个<el-input>作为params传入后端 前端vue的<el-input>如何编码? // 查询参数 queryParams里对应的属性如何编码? 简而言之,就是前端的<el-input> 如作为params额外传入后端??? 许可可 创建了任务 4年前 许可可 将关联仓库设置为若依/RuoYi-Vue...
el-input上添加autofocus并没有自动聚焦的效果 <el-inputautofocusv-model="word"></el-input> 1. 解决方案 <el-inputref="inputRef"v-model="word"></el-input> 1. mounted() { // 在input输入框被渲染完毕后再获取焦点 this.$nextTick(() => { ...
<input type="submit" value="下载"> </form> ``` 在Servlet中,我们可以通过以下代码处理下载请求: ```java import java.io.File; import java.io.IOException; import javax.servlet.ServletException; import javax.servlet.annotation.MultipartConfig; import javax.servlet.annotation.WebServlet; import javax....